WSHS Orchestra cellist Jenny Schmidt was chosen by orchestra members to receive this year's National School Orchestra Award, an award which is given annually in each high school orchestra across the country to the senior who most embodies the spirit of the orchestra. Jenny has participated in Minnesota Music Listening Contest, in quartets and small ensembles within the orchestra, and was also chosen for Big 9 Select Orchestra, according to WSHS Orchestra Director Cindy Johnson.
Tony Pham was this year's recipient of the CodaBow award, given by CodaBow International, the Winona company that makes and sells fine instrument bows used around the world. According to Jeff Van Fossen, one of the founders of CodaBow and the originator of the award, it is given with the hope that, "playing of this CodaBow should always be a reminder of the community that cared and the classmates who shared their passion for string playing." This recipient is chosen by orchestra peers as the person who embodies the inspiration, joy, and personal growth that string playing can provide. Tony is shown with Nathan Davies admiring his new bow; Tony was Nathan's mentor in the orchestra's new mentor program in which a WSHS Orchestra member works with a fifth grade orchestra student.
